The ingredients needed to cook Pancetta & Mushroom Carbonara Style:
- Prepare 200 g penne pasta
- You need 40 g clotted cream
- Take 80 g pancetta
- Use 2 eggs
- Take 40 g hard Italian cheese
- You need 10 g chives
- Get 3 garlic cloves
- You need 160 g mushrooms
Instructions to make Pancetta & Mushroom Carbonara Style:
- Boil a kettle
- Add the boiled water, with salt to a pot over a high heat, enough to cover the pasta. Then once the water is bubbling add the pasta for about 8mins until cooked with a bite. Once cooked, drain but retain about a ladel worth of the water. Keep the pasta in the pot until later.
- Meanwhile…. Finely dice/crush/grate the garlic.
- Grate the cheese finely.
- Finely cut the chives.
- Heat a large pot with a drizzle of olive over a medium to high heat. Once hot add the pancetta and brown.
- Meanwhile, crack the eggs into a jug, add the chives, clotted cream and cheese and beat with a fork until fully mixed.
- Once the pancetta is browned, reduce the heat to low and add the garlic, cook for another 2mins.
- Chop or tear the mushrooms into bitesize pieces, then add them to the pot and cooked for a further 2-3mins.
- Once ready, add the pasta and reserved pasta cooking water to the pot. Reglaze the pot and stir well. Increase the heat temporarily to reduce the liquid by 2/3rds.
- Add the egg mix to the pot, reducing heat to low and continue to stir until the mixture is cooked, creating a creamy sauce that fully coats all the pasta.
- Serve
